Gefran launches XPSA pressure transmitters

Gefran XPSA pressure transmitters use a bonded strain gauge measurement technique to produce a rugged, compact sensor with a stainless steel diaphragm.

Research focuses on torque measurement system

Research in the Power Conversion Group at Manchester University, led by Dr Nigel Schofield, is focusing on the use of a non-contact torque measurement system developed by Sensor Technology.
